Who We Are

Rainbow Community Places offers safe(r) and welcoming places for 2SLGBTQIA+ community members through free, weekly drop-in programs.

​

Located in southwest Scarborough, our current programs are Toby’s Place for 2SLGBTQIA+ youth (ages 13 to 20) and Dorothy’s Place for 2SLGBTQIA+ older adults (55+). Our vision is to expand these programs and add new programs.

How You Can Help

Rainbow Community Places is seeking applications for up to 3 new board members. The Board is a working board, meeting monthly, usually at 7pm on the first Thursday of the month. The volunteer board members oversee staff and provide leadership for strategic planning, financial management, financial development and fundraising, human resources and administration.
